Speed percent vs increased speeds in slicer

Is there any difference between setting the print speed on the printer to 200% vs doubling everything in the slicer? I am printing some TPU of questionable quality and I have my speed set low (15mm/s) and I want to speed it up to see when quality and proper extrusion are lost. Would increasing the printer % be sufficient and  is there any unintended consequences I should be worried about?

RE: Speed percent vs increased speeds in slicer

print speeds on the LCD don't seem to change travel speeds.
 
changing speeds doesn't always speed prints up as much as you would hope. 
there are maximum speeds and acceleration rates in firmware, and the Maximum Volumetric speed also limits print speed
the printer doesnt reach full speed on short lengths, it needs longer stretches of print trace, to reach full speed
